Yesterday I posted the top 20 players by team and zone adjusted Corsi ratings. The leader is Zdeno Chara of the Boston Bruins. He was also the leader in 2010/11. This shows that Zdeno Chara has been the best player in terms of puck possession for the last two years running. When he is on the ice his team has the puck more than any other team even when you correct for his teammates and the zone starts he plays. I think this allows us to make the argument that Chara is the best player in the NHL today.

Tyler Seguin Most Important Young Forward for the Bruins This Upcoming Season (Video)
Tyler Seguin won a Stanley Cup in his first professional season and he has been rather stellar since joining the Bruins. In 81 games last season for the reigning Stanley Cup Champions, Seguin had 29 goals and 67 points. He is thought to be one of, if not the most exciting young talent in the National Hockey League. Shawn Thornton Hosts Chariy Golf Tournament, Isn't Worried About CBA Negotiations (Video)
Shawn Thornton is finding ways to keep himself occupied during the Bruins offseason while the NHL hammers out a new collective bargaining agreement. On Monday, he swapped his hockey stick for a golf club when he hosted his third annual Putts and Punches for Parkinson's golf tournament.
